An aqueous solution of hydrogen sulphide shows the equilibrium, `H_2S ⇌ H^+ + HS^-` if dilute hydrochloric acid is added to an aqueous solution of hydrogen sulphide without any change in temperature:

A

The equilibrium constant will change

B

The concentration `HS^-` will increase

C

The concentration of undissociated hydrogen sulphide will decrease

D

The concentration of `HS^-`will decrease.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D
